MIXI Begins Supporting Yoyogi Junior High School’s Programming Seminar
Supporting each student’s inquiry-based learning through hands-on experiences with programming and generative AI
Tokyo, Japan, August 4, 2026 — MIXI, Inc. hereby announces that, as of June 12, 2026, it has begun providing support for Shibuya City Yoyogi Junior High School’s programming seminar. This seminar is one of the inquiry-based learning programs that the school is implementing in the 2026-27 school year.
For this school year, the school has adopted the following inquiry themes: “Aiming for Authentic Inquiry-Based Learning” and “Aiming for Inquiry-Based Learning Related to Society (Fostering Practical Skills).” Based on these themes, students choose a topic that interests them from among several seminar options, such as programming, video production, and cooking. They engage in individual inquiry activities, working on self-defined projects leading up to the final presentation of their results in December.
As part of this initiative, MIXI is leading the programming workshop. Over the course of approximately 10 sessions from June through December, we support each student in bringing their ideas to life by introducing IT engineering work, providing hands-on experience with HTML and Python, and showcasing examples of how generative AI is used.

About 25 students are participating in the programming seminar, and we held three sessions during the first semester. The first half of the seminar is devoted to lectures and working on assigned tasks, while the second half is dedicated to the students’ own research projects. The activities MIXI carried out during the first semester are as follows.
| Date | Description |
| June 12 | Through an introduction to IT engineering careers and worksheets, students consider the fields they want to pursue and the goals they want to achieve. |
| June 19 | Students try their hand at HTML and create their own profile page. |
| July 10 | Students load a stylesheet (CSS) created by generative AI into their own HTML to see how the design changes. During the second half, we held a Minecraft command challenge quiz for those who were interested. |

In the second half of the seminar, in addition to HTML, students will work on creating mini-applications, games, and tools using Python, as well as experimenting with sample code that utilizes generative AI. In the final session in December, students will create and present their projects.
Comment from Akira Tanabe, MIXI engineer leading the seminar
During the first semester, I talked with students and used surveys to find out what each student was aiming for. “Games” frequently came up as one of the things they wanted to try, so I could really relate to how everyone felt. Since many students chose to work on something related to Minecraft, I provided a variety of activities, such as a Minecraft quiz, while also gauging their engagement. I hope that they’ll develop an interest in programming through their other interests.
